I prefer a chrome lined barrel on my high use rifles, at least until there is a definitive comparison between chrome and melonite (which I also like), and the GM barrel is a mid weight which provides a stiffer barrel than a light or pencil profile can...less POI shift at high temps than a lighter profile.

If its not that important to you then get a lighter barrel.

Faxon and Ballistic Advantage make great products,  I just prefer the medium profile and chrome lined GM...or a Spikes "Optimal Profile" if you can find a deal on one, but they are a bit pricier than the others.

Boron (nickle boron) is an actual coating that can, in some rare cases, flake off...whereas nitride (melonite, etc) is a chemical treatment that does not add to the dimensions or have the ability to flake off.
